Hi NO WAY TO SAY THIS NICE: SO YOU ARE NOT ALLOWED TO SELL PERMITS.

Try doing the day hike permit first then as a last ditch overnight on the North Fork permit system . Picking any time the first three weeks of August is rough. Wait a week and head in with a no show permit.

East face is a 8-10 hour car to car hike if your are in shape and solid climber, spend some days in the high country to get ready for the elevation and approach. It would be good to have a member of the party that has been on the route several times.Do two on a rope and out the same canyon.
The buttress is cleaner and a better climb as an option. Thanks Doug
